Если вы только начинаете знакомиться с миром Telegram и хотите создать своего собственного бота, но не знаете, с чего начать — вы попали по адресу! В этой статье мы разберём, как создать и настроить Telegram-бота с нуля, без сложного программирования, используя удобные сервисы и инструменты. Вы узнаете, как зарегистрировать бота, задать ему имя и username, настроить команды и функции, а также обеспечить безопасность и тестирование.
Основы создания и регистрации Telegram-бота
Что такое @BotFather и как с ним работать?
@BotFather — это официальный бот в Telegram, который служит для создания и управления другими ботами. Он как "крёстный отец" всех ботов в Telegram: именно через него вы создаёте нового бота и получаете секретный ключ доступа, который нужен для дальнейшей работы.
Как зарегистрировать своего первого Telegram-бота через @BotFather?
- Откройте Telegram и найдите @BotFather.
- Нажмите Start или отправьте команду
/start
. - Введите команду
/newbot
, чтобы создать нового бота. - Придумайте имя бота — это будет отображаемое имя, можно использовать русский или английский язык.
- Задайте уникальный username бота — он должен быть написан латиницей и обязательно заканчиваться на
bot
(например, MyFirstTestBot). - После создания вы получите уникальный токен — длинную строку символов, которая является секретным ключом доступа к вашему боту.
Как сохранить и обезопасить секретный ключ?
Токен — это ключ к вашему боту, с помощью которого можно управлять им и подключать к сервисам. Никому не показывайте этот ключ и храните его в надёжном месте. Потеря или утечка токена может привести к взлому бота и неправильной работе.
Настройка и конфигурация Telegram-бота без программирования
Какие инструменты использовать?
Если вы не умеете программировать, не беда! Есть сервисы-конструкторы, которые позволяют настроить бота без кода. Один из самых популярных — это @Manybot. С его помощью можно быстро добавить команды, настроить ответы и даже делать рассылки.
Как настроить команды и функции через @Manybot?
- Добавьте своего бота в @Manybot.
- Используйте простой интерфейс для создания команд (например,
/help
,/start
). - Настройте автоматические ответы на часто задаваемые вопросы.
- Можно создавать кнопки и меню для удобства пользователя.
Как загрузить профильное изображение или GIF?
- В @BotFather есть команда
Edit Description Picture
, где можно загрузить изображение размером 640×360 пикселей или GIF. - Рекомендуется использовать яркое и понятное изображение, чтобы бот выглядел привлекательно.
- Для создания картинки можно воспользоваться простыми графическими редакторами, например, Supa.
Какие настройки профиля улучшат восприятие бота?
- Имя — должно быть понятным и отражать суть бота.
- Описание About — кратко расскажите, что делает бот и для кого он.
- Описание Description — появляется перед нажатием кнопки “Старт”, мотивируйте пользователя начать общение.
- Фото или GIF — визуальный образ бота помогает выделиться и запомниться.
Разработка логики и интеграция функций Telegram-бота
Как разработать эффективную логику?
Подумайте, какие задачи должен решать ваш бот. Например:
- Принимать заказы.
- Отвечать на частые вопросы.
- Поддерживать клиентов.
Грамотно спланируйте сценарии общения. Например, при заказе бот может спрашивать детали и подтверждать их.
Как объединить несколько функций в одном боте?
Telegram-бот может выполнять сразу несколько задач: продавать, консультировать, отправлять рассылки. Главное — продумать структуру меню и команд, чтобы пользователю было удобно переключаться между функциями.
Как подключить бота к внешним сервисам?
Для расширения возможностей можно интегрировать бота с сервисами вроде Livegram Bot, Target Hunter, Unisender:
- Скопируйте токен бота из @BotFather.
- Войдите в сервис интеграции и подключите бота через API.
- Настройте сценарии, рассылки и обработку данных.
Какие функции стоит включить для повышения вовлечённости?
- Автоматические ответы на частые вопросы.
- Возможность оставить заявку или заказать товар.
- Рассылки с новостями и акциями.
- Поддержка в реальном времени через группу с менеджерами.
Тестирование, безопасность и сопровождение бота
Как тестировать бота до запуска?
- Проверьте все команды и сценарии в личном чате с ботом.
- Попробуйте разные варианты запросов, чтобы убедиться, что бот отвечает корректно.
- Добавьте бота в тестовую группу для проверки работы с несколькими пользователями.
Какие меры безопасности соблюдать?
- Никому не передавайте токен бота.
- Храните ключ в защищённом месте.
- Не сохраняйте личные данные пользователей без необходимости.
- При подозрениях на взлом — сразу обновите токен через @BotFather.
Как развивать и обновлять бота?
- Следите за отзывами пользователей.
- Добавляйте новые команды и функции по мере необходимости.
- Используйте аналитику для понимания, что работает, а что нет.
- Периодически обновляйте и улучшайте сценарии.
Когда простой бот уже не подходит?
Если задачи становятся сложными, например, требуется сложная логика, интеграция с CRM или базы данных, то приходит время переходить к программированию или использовать более продвинутые платформы. Но для начала простой бот — отличный инструмент.
Таблица: Краткий обзор этапов создания и настройки Telegram-бота
Этап | Описание | Инструменты/команды |
---|---|---|
Регистрация бота | Создать бота через @BotFather, получить токен | /newbot в @BotFather |
Настройка имени и username | Задать имя и уникальный username (на латинице, оканчивается на bot) | Edit Name , Edit Username в @BotFather |
Загрузка профиля | Добавить фото или GIF, описание | Edit Description Picture в @BotFather |
Настройка команд | Создать команды и ответы без программирования | @Manybot или аналогичные сервисы |
Разработка логики | Спланировать сценарии работы и функции | Встроенные инструменты конструктора |
Интеграция с сервисами | Подключить к внешним платформам для расширения функций | Livegram Bot, Target Hunter, Unisender |
Тестирование и безопасность | Проверить работу, защитить токен и данные | Тестовый чат, обновление токена |
Обновление и развитие | Добавлять функции, улучшать логику | Аналитика, отзывы пользователей |
Итог
Создать и настроить бота в Telegram проще, чем кажется! Главное — начать с официального бота @BotFather, получить токен и задать имя. Далее можно использовать сервисы-конструкторы, например, @Manybot, чтобы быстро добавить команды и функции без программирования. Не забывайте про оформление профиля — это повышает доверие и удобство пользователей. Для более сложных задач подключайте внешние сервисы и развивайте бота постепенно.
Не бойтесь экспериментировать! Ваш бот — это ваш помощник, который может работать 24/7, отвечать клиентам и даже принимать заказы. Начните с простого, а дальше — расширяйте функционал и автоматизируйте бизнес-процессы. Удачи в создании вашего первого Telegram-бота!
P.S. Помните: ваш бот — это не просто программа, а лицо вашего проекта в Telegram. Сделайте его удобным, полезным и безопасным.
22 июня 2025